Comparative performance of OM-OFDM in broadband systems

A method called offset modulation (OM-OFDM) is proposed to control the peak-to-average power ratio (PAPR) of an OFDM signal. The authors demonstrate the significant modulation, structural and performance differences between an OM-OFDM and CE-OFDM method. The OM-OFDM method in addition is able to accurately control the PAPR of a transmission for a targeted BER, which is currently not possible with CE-OFDM. By using a power performance decision metric (D), the OM-OFDM method is shown to offer a 34 dB and 3.44 dB net power performance gain (at a BER of 10−4) when compared to a CE-OFDM and traditional OFDM transmission for frequency selective fading channel conditions, respectively.

متن کاملSelective Tone Reservation Method for PAPR Reduction of Spatially Multiplexed OFDM Systems
Tone Reservation (TR) is one of the well-known methods for PAPR reduction of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ing (OFDM) systems. In this method some sub-carriers are reserved for PAPR reduction and the symbols in these sub-carriers are selected such that the PAPR of the OFDM frame is minimized.
